IPL’s new logo unveiled ahead of season 10. Image Source: twitter

Internet Desk: The logo for the 10th edition of the Indian Premier League (IPL) was unveiled on Tuesday. The logo represents 10 years of the cash-rich tournament with an iconic batsman playing an attacking shot alongside the logos of Vivo and IPL.

The fans will experience a multi city Trophy Tour for the first time in ten years of VIVO IPL history. Fans can also experience a stadium-like environment at IPL fan parks across 38 cities this year.

The IPL Player Auction 2017 took place on February 20 which featured over 350 players who went up for bidding. 66 players were bought in the auction which included 27 overseas players. Ben Stokes was the most expensive player who fetched a Rs.14.5 crore deal with Rising Pune Supergiants. He was followed by teammate Tymal Mills who was sold for Rs. 12 crores to Royal Challengers Bangalore.

There were a few shockers in the auction as well. South African leg-spinner Imran Tahir found no takers. It was shocking to see him going unsold as he is currently ruling over ODI and T20I rankings. Indian pacer Ishant Sharma too went unsold.

There were several speculations surrounding Indian all-rounder Irfan Pathan who did not get any bidders. His base price was Rs 50 lakhs. It came as a surprise to everyone as he performed well in Inter-State Syed Mushtaq Ali Trophy.
